I hope someone can help me, I totally PC illiterate! At least two icons on the bottom right of my screen have disappeared, The sound Control and the one with the 2 TV screens??. I have tried the Help section on the Pc but have been unable to find how to get these back. Many thanks for anyones help.

Welcome to the forum..........
happywave.gif


Right click Start/orb > Properties > And take it from there. You can customize what you want on your task bar. If the icons suddenly vanished though i'd run some kind of Antivirus/MAlware program to rule out any nasties...
